What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— spent $675,494 more than it took in. Revenue $70,416,266 · expenses $71,091,760 · reserve months 20.9
Tax year 2022 — took in $2,893,592 more than it spent. Revenue $62,070,761 · expenses $59,177,169 · reserve months 22.5
Tax year 2021 — took in $2,198,773 more than it spent. Revenue $59,541,606 · expenses $57,342,833 · reserve months 25.5
Tax year 2020 — spent $1,463,325 more than it took in. Revenue $54,552,876 · expenses $56,016,201 · reserve months 23.9
Tax year 2019 — took in $198,538 more than it spent. Revenue $58,182,441 · expenses $57,983,903 · reserve months 21.8
Tax year 2018 — took in $727,604 more than it spent. Revenue $44,429,021 · expenses $43,701,417 · reserve months 26.7
Tax year 2017 — took in $12,543,879 more than it spent. Revenue $53,509,825 · expenses $40,965,946 · reserve months 29.7
Tax year 2016 — took in $3,761,360 more than it spent. Revenue $42,603,112 · expenses $38,841,752 · reserve months 28.2
Tax year 2015 — took in $3,143,834 more than it spent. Revenue $42,245,627 · expenses $39,101,793 · reserve months 24.8
Tax year 2014 — took in $5,956,180 more than it spent. Revenue $41,904,467 · expenses $35,948,287 · reserve months 27.4
Tax year 2013 — took in $3,816,004 more than it spent. Revenue $39,313,056 · expenses $35,497,052 · reserve months 27.0
Tax year 2012 — took in $7,631,168 more than it spent. Revenue $40,269,164 · expenses $32,637,996 · reserve months 25.9
Tax year 2011 — took in $4,213,140 more than it spent. Revenue $36,474,709 · expenses $32,261,569 · reserve months 23.4
